Federal Acquisition Regulation; Contingent Fee Representation

AGENCIES: Department of Defense (DOD), General Services Administration 
(GSA), and National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A).

ACTION: Final rule.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: The Civilian Agency Acquisition Council and the Defense 
Acquisition Regulations Council have agreed on a final rule amending 
the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) to delete the provision 
requiring an offeror to provide a contingent fee representation and 
agreement and to submit a statement of contingent or other fees. This 
regulatory action was not subject to Office of Management and Budget 
review under Executive Order 12866, dated September 30, 1993, and is 
not a major rule under 5 U.S.C. 804.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:

A. Background

    FAR 3.404(b) requires the contracting officer to insert the 
provision at 52.203-4, Contingent Fee Representation and Agreement, in 
all solicitations, with six exceptions. The provision requires offerors 
to provide a contingent fee representation as requested by the 
contracting officer. When the representation is answered affirmatively, 
the offeror must also provide a completed Standard Form (SF) 119, 
Statement of Contingent or Other Fees, or a signed statement indicating 
the SF 119 was previously submitted to the same contracting office. A 
proposed rule was published in the Federal Register at 60 FR 57140, 
November 13, 1995. This final rule revises FAR 3.404 to remove the 
requirement for the solicitation provision and removes the accompanying 
sections 3.405 through 3.408 which deal with the SF 119. FAR 3.409 and 
3.410 have been renumbered.

B. Regulatory Flexibility Act

    The Department of Defense, the General Services Administration, and 
the National Aeronautics and Space Administration certify that this 
final rule will not have a significant economic impact on a substantial 
number of small entities within the meaning of the Regulatory 
Flexibility Act, 5 U.S.C. 601, et seq., because there is a slight 
beneficial impact on small entities since offerors will no longer be 
required to provide contingent fee representations and agreements or to 
submit statements of contingent or other fees. However, the underlying 
policy pertaining to contingent fee arrangements has not changed.

C. Paperwork Reduction Act

    The Paperwork Reduction Act (Pub. L. 96-511) is deemed to apply 
because the final rule eliminates a previously approved information 
collection requirement under Office of Management and Budget (OMB) 
number 9000-0003, Statement of Contingent or Other Fees (SF 119). 
Accordingly, a request for elimination of the information collection 
requirement is being submitted to OMB.
